Nearly all non-urgent surgery and outpatient clinics are cancelled today, as thousands of nurses go on strike.
In Auckland, only two vaccination centres will open, with the lack of available nurses prompting safety concerns.
At 11am, nurses will down tools to join marches and pickets across the country as they attempt to highlight anger with pay and work conditions.
